The 10th annual Monarch Tag and Release was held at Dorothy’s House Museum on Ganaraska Road in Port Hope on Saturday, August 24, 2019.

The event ran from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. and was a chance for all visitors to learn more about monarch butterflies and their migration to Mexico each year. Don Davis from North York was on hand to answer any questions about monarch butterflies.
